I need to make some dalmatian cupcakes this week for my son's party to go with a firetruck cake.

I found the basic idea on the wilton site, but need help making it look more like a dalmatian. They used tootsie rolls to mold ears & nose. Would you suggest black candy melts, MMF, or maybe try to color the tootsie rolls black? Tootsie rolls are easy to work with.

yes i just use a 1/3 cup corn syrup to a pound of chocolate.

To make them look more like a dalmatian i would two tone the ears and maybe put a spot on the top of the face.

pg. 67 of the "hello, cupcake" book has directions/pics/template for making a dalmatian cupcake....they don't look difficult to do and use thin chocolate cookies, marshmallows (reg & min), starbursts, black jelly beans & mini m & m's.
